  • Advanced Fiberglass Spectra® composite weave shell.
  • Lightweight, superior fit and comfort using advanced CAD technology.
  • Meets or exceeds SNELL & DOT standards.
  • Hard coated and optically superior 3D shield design provides 95% UV protection and an anti-scratch coating.
  • Comes with a Pinlock shield installed for the ultimate anti-fog system.
  • RapidFire Shield Replacement System: Quick, secure, tool-less removal and installation.
  • 2-stage Shield Closure Mechanism: Compresses shield into the eye port gasket providing an extremely secure seal.
  • "ACS" Advanced Channeling Ventilation System: Full front to back airflow flushes heat and humidity up and out.
  • SilverCool Interior: Removable washable moisture wicking interior.
  • Advanced silver anti-bacterial odor free fabric.
  • Streamline, wrap-around neck roll reduces wind noise.
  • Available in sizes XS thru 2XL.

 Smooth Sailing

By Lucas from Atascadero, CA

Pros: No Turbulence, Great Shield Mechanics, Decent AIr Flow,

Cons: Chin strap is a little too close to the neck, Chin bar sticks out a little too far in front

Sizing Info: Fits true to size

Firstly, I have an oval shaped head. I am 100% certain this dictates much of my likes and dislikes for this lid. I only have 1 other lid to compare this too (Shoei RF1000). IMO, the Shoei is very loud (booming from neck area at speed), while the HJC is much quieter. I really dislike loudness, so the HJC is my preferred lid between the two. This is interesting, as it seems my ears are closer to being exposed in the HJC and more air flows through it in general. It is much better for warm weather. In cold weather, it lets way too much air through. The HJC has absolutely no wind turbulence... it slices through the wind in tuck or upright position. The shield is very easy to take off and put back on. No complaints on the lining.. it seems to be good material. I don't like how the chin bar on the HJC sticks out so far in front of my face. It seems like it impedes my vision when I am looking at my cluster... and just gives the "fish bowl" effect overall. In comparison, the Shoei is very compact... my nose actually touches the inside. In this regard, I prefer the Shoei. The HJC chin strap also is on the verge of being uncomfortably close to my neck. Summary - the HJC is great for warm weather, has very minimal turbulence, is quiet (in comparison to my other lid). Only thing I don't like is the size of the shell overall.
